  • Patent number: 6519828
    Abstract: Description and illustration of a method for mounting a metal body (1) on an essentially straight measuring tube (2), made of titanium or zirconium, of a Coriolis mass flowmeter. The method ensures secure retention of the metal body (1) on the measuring tube (2) even through very extended operation of the Coriolis mass flowmeter, in that the metal body (1) is shrink-mounted on the measuring tube (2).

  • Publication number: 20020107325
    Abstract: Clearcoat coating composition for automotive exterior coatings with improved intercoat adhesion to a subsequently applied coating layer and improved flexibility contains (a) a first vinyl copolymer prepared from a monomer mixture including no more than about 35% by weight of nonfunctional monomers that has carbamate functionality and hydroxyl functionality, at least part of the hydroxyl functionality being on monomer units including an optionally branched alkyl group having at least about six carbon atoms; (b) a second vinyl copolymer having hydroxyl functionality, preferably primary hydroxyl functionality; and (c) a curing agent component that includes at least an aminoplast curing agent and optionally a polyisocyanate curing agent. The polyisocyanate curing agent is preferably blocked with a blocking agent that volatilizes during the cure reaction, regenerating a reactive isocyanate group.

  • Patent number: 6397685
    Abstract: A mass flowmeter operating by the Coriolis principle and incorporating an essentially straight, moving-fluid-conducting Coriolis measuring tube, at least one oscillator associated with and exciting the Coriolis measuring tube, at least one detector associated with the Coriolis measuring tube and sensing the Coriolis forces and/or the Coriolis oscillations generated by Coriolis forces, and a compensating cylinder in which the Coriolis measuring tube is positioned, the Coriolis measuring tube and the compensating cylinder being connected to each other in which the oscillation-capable system composed of the Coriolis measuring tube and the compensating cylinder is at least to a large extent mass-equalized both for the excitation oscillation of the Coriolis measuring tube and for the Coriolis oscillation of the Coriolis measuring tube.
